Craft Clear, Specific Prompts

When creating AI tutorials, start with ultra-clear prompts. Tell the AI exactly what you want, step-by-step. For example, say "Write a 3-paragraph guide on how to grow tomatoes for beginners" instead of just "Write about gardening." Aim for prompts that are at least 20 words long. This helps the AI give you much better results.

Test and Refine Your Outputs

Don't settle for the first AI response. Try asking for the same thing in different ways. Then pick the best parts from each answer. Aim to generate at least 3 versions of each tutorial section. This helps you find the clearest, most helpful content. Keep track of which prompts work best so you can use them again later.

Add Real-World Examples

Sprinkle in specific examples throughout your tutorial. This makes the content way more useful. For instance, include actual dialogue snippets showing how to talk to AI. Or add screenshots of AI outputs. Try to include at least one concrete example for every main point you make. This brings your tutorial to life and helps people apply what they learn.

Choose an Engaging Location

Pick a virtual field trip destination that will wow your students. Aim for places they can't easily visit in person, like the International Space Station or the Great Barrier Reef. Use 360-degree videos or interactive panoramas to make it feel real. Try to find tours with clickable hotspots so students can explore on their own. Measure engagement by tracking how long students spend interacting and how many areas they visit. Avoid just using static images - they won't hold attention.

Create Clear Learning Goals

Set 3-5 specific objectives for what students should learn from the virtual trip. For example, "Identify 3 adaptations penguins have for living in Antarctica." Make an activity sheet with questions tied to each goal. Have students complete it during the tour to stay focused. Check comprehension by having them share their top 3 takeaways afterwards. Don't make it a passive experience - keep students actively learning throughout.

Create Milestone Challenges

Set up milestone challenges to gamify your learning content. Break your course into 5-10 key milestones. For each milestone, create a fun challenge that tests the main skills learned. Aim for challenges that take 15-30 minutes to complete. Track completion rates and aim for 80%+ of students finishing each challenge.

Use Leaderboards Wisely

Add a leaderboard to spark friendly competition, but be careful not to demotivate slower learners. Display the top 10-20% of performers and allow students to opt-out if desired. Refresh the board weekly to keep it dynamic. Measure engagement by tracking how often students check their rank - shoot for 3+ views per week on average.

Reward Learning Streaks

Implement a streak system to encourage consistent engagement. Award badges for 3, 7, and 30-day learning streaks. Make streaks visible on student profiles. To avoid burnout, allow a 1-day grace period before breaking a streak. Track the average streak length and work to increase it by 10% each month through targeted reminders and rewards.

Create 2-Minute Micro-Lessons

Break down complex topics into bite-sized, 2-minute video lessons. Focus on one key concept per video. Use visuals like diagrams or animations to explain ideas quickly. Aim for a 70% retention rate by having viewers take a short quiz after each micro-lesson.

Use Spaced Repetition

Schedule short review sessions at increasing intervals. Send 30-second recap videos to learners 1 day, 1 week, and 1 month after the initial lesson. This reinforces key points and boosts long-term memory. Track engagement rates for these follow-ups, aiming for 50%+ completion.

Avoid Information Overload

Stick to 3-5 main points per micro-lesson. Cut out any unnecessary details or jargon. Use simple language and real-world examples. A common mistake is trying to cram too much into each video. Remember, less is more when it comes to micro-learning.
